Harold Jay “Sam” McCauslin, 89, of Stephens City, Virginia, passed away on Saturday, April 11, 2020, at Winchester Medical Center. Mr. McCauslin was born in Wenksville, Pennsylvania, in 1931, the son of the late Mary A. and Lee A. McCauslin.
